When you have the results of your home examination, you have a number of options: If the issues are too considerable or too expensive to fix, you can select to ignore the purchase as long as the purchase agreement has an evaluation contingency. For issues large or small, you can ask the seller to repair them, lower the purchase rate, or offer you a cash credit at near to repair the issues yourself.

If these alternatives aren't viable in your scenario (for example, if the residential or commercial property is bank-owned or being offered as-is), you can get estimates to fix the issues yourself and develop a plan for repairs in order of their significance and affordability once you own the home. Legally, you don't have to get anything fixed after a home examination.

An assessment will always discover a problem with a house. Even new home buildings will have small issues that require to be resolved.

They may negotiate on a few of them, but expecting a resolution of all problems is unreasonable. After a house assessment, you can ask your broker to work out any essential repairs with the sellers or ask the sellers to decrease the rate so you can fix the issues yourself. Getting quotes from regional specialists will help you write out a counter offer based upon price quotes, however a purchaser needs to be conscious that a seller is not obligated to repair anything.
